What's career growth & development like at Evolv Technology?

Strengths in stated internal mobility, mentorship, and access to education are accompanied by concerns about constrained advancement in some areas, variability in formal training depth, and limited transparency on promotion pathways. Together, these dynamics suggest a growth-supportive environment with meaningful resources, tempered by uneven execution and the need for team-specific clarity on advancement.

Evidence in Action

  • Promote From Within The 'Promote from within' benefit appears in Evolv's professional development materials alongside mentorship and tuition reimbursement. This sets an expectation of internal mobility and encourages employees to grow skills for advancement without leaving the company.
  • EvolvED Onboarding Program The EvolvED new-hire training and technical product onboarding standardize early learning across roles touching hardware, ML, sensors, and integrations. Employees ramp quickly, build cross-functional fluency, and accelerate career progression in a safety-critical, mission-driven environment.

Positive Themes About Evolv Technology

  • Internal Mobility: Benefits explicitly include “Promote from within,” signaling deliberate support for advancing existing employees. Formal programs and cultural messaging emphasize growing talent internally as part of retention and development.
  • Mentorship & Sponsorship: Mentorship is highlighted through a structured program and examples of interns progressing with strong mentor support. Guidance paired with challenging expectations is portrayed as a catalyst for growth.
  • Training & Education Access: Paid industry certifications, tuition reimbursement, continuing education stipends, online course subscriptions, and lunch-and-learns provide structured avenues to upskill. Job training and conferences further reinforce access to learning.

Considerations About Evolv Technology

  • Limited Mobility: Upward movement in certain areas is portrayed as constrained, with higher roles sometimes filled externally. Recent organizational changes are noted as potentially limiting near-term internal advancement opportunities.
  • Lack of Learning & Training: Compared to some peers, formal professional development depth may be less robust despite strong on-the-job learning. Program strength appears to vary by team and function.
  • Unclear Advancement: Public materials provide limited detail on promotion frequency and processes. Candidates are advised to seek team-specific examples and clarity during interviews.
